Understanding CFDs (Contract for Difference)
Before diving into the evaluation of Bitcoin 360 Ai's legitimacy, it is important to understand the concept of CFDs. A CFD, or Contract for Difference, is a financial derivative that allows traders to speculate on the price movements of an underlying asset, such as a cryptocurrency, without actually owning the asset itself.
When trading CFDs, the trader enters into a contract with a broker, agreeing to exchange the difference in the price of an asset from the time the contract is opened to the time it is closed. If the trader predicts the price movement correctly, they can profit from the difference. However, if the trader's prediction is incorrect, they may incur losses.
CFDs offer several advantages for cryptocurrency traders, including the ability to trade on margin, access to a wide range of assets, and the potential for both long and short positions. However, they also come with their own set of risks, including the possibility of losing more than the initial investment, the reliance on a trusted broker, and the potential for market manipulation.
Real Cryptocurrencies vs CFDs
When it comes to cryptocurrency trading, investors have the option to trade real cryptocurrencies or engage in CFD trading. Each approach has its own advantages and disadvantages.
Trading real cryptocurrencies involves buying and selling actual digital assets, such as Bitcoin or Ethereum. This method allows investors to own the underlying asset and potentially benefit from its long-term growth. However, trading real cryptocurrencies requires the investor to set up a digital wallet, navigate cryptocurrency exchanges, and manage the security and storage of their digital assets.
On the other hand, CFD trading offers a more simplified approach to cryptocurrency trading. With CFDs, investors do not need to own the underlying asset. Instead, they can speculate on the price movements of the asset and potentially profit from both rising and falling markets. CFD trading also allows investors to trade on margin, providing the opportunity for larger potential returns. However, it is important to note that CFD trading does not offer ownership of the underlying asset, and the investor is subject to the terms and conditions set by the broker.

Red Flags and Scam Indicators
When evaluating the legitimacy of a cryptocurrency trading platform like Bitcoin 360 Ai, it is important to be aware of common red flags and scam indicators. Some warning signs to watch out for include:
-
Unrealistic promises of guaranteed profits: If a platform claims to offer guaranteed profits or consistently high returns, it is likely too good to be true. Cryptocurrency markets are highly volatile, and there are inherent risks involved in trading.
-
Lack of transparency and information: If a platform is vague or secretive about its operations, technology, or team members, it may be a red flag. Legitimate platforms are usually transparent about their processes and provide detailed information about their team and technology.
-
Poor customer reviews and ratings: Negative user reviews and low ratings can indicate a platform's poor performance or potential scams. It is important to consider multiple sources of reviews and assess the overall sentiment.
- Unregulated or unlicensed operation: Regulatory oversight is crucial in the cryptocurrency industry to protect investors. If a platform is not regulated or licensed by reputable financial authorities, it may pose higher risks.
To protect oneself from potential scams, it is advisable to conduct thorough research, seek advice from trusted sources, and only invest what one can afford to lose. It is also important to be cautious when sharing personal and financial information and to use secure platforms and wallets for cryptocurrency transactions.
